TECHNICAL SPECIFICATIONS

  • Brand: Hewlett Packard Enterprise (HPE)
  • Manufacturer: Hewlett Packard Enterprise (HPE)
  • Model Number: 875474-B21
  • Product Type: Enterprise Solid State Drive (SSD)
  • Series: HPE Enterprise SATA SSD
  • Storage Capacity: 960GB
  • Interface: SATA 6Gb/s (SATA III)
  • Form Factor: 2.5-inch Small Form Factor (SFF)
  • Workload Type: Mixed Use (MU) – Balanced Read/Write
  • Drive Type: Internal Hot-Plug SSD
  • Carrier Type: HPE Smart Carrier (SC)
  • Firmware: HPE Digitally Signed Firmware
  • Compatibility: HPE ProLiant Gen8 / Gen9 / Gen10 Servers
